To me one of the big things that differentiates Lemmy (and the fediverse in general) from email is that most of it is public, so the things in email that would involve sharing someone’s private information (email addresses, IPs, email contents, etc) are public (at least the post/comment and username+instance), and can all be verified. I think there is a lot of potential because of this. Maybe I’m crazy, but I just really don’t like the idea of a whitelist-based system because it means I as a small instance operator may have to sign up to dozens of services like the one you are building. I want my instance to be able to federate pretty much as widely as possible, and to me such a burden is too much to ask within a system/protocol/fediverse that is designed to facilitate sharing and decentralization.
Also, I think there is already room for a problem with “capture”. What motivation is there for .world .ml or beehaw to bother signing up for your thing? Even assuming you get 100 like minded admins to sign up for Overseer that is probably a pretty small fediverse island without them, some or all “mega” instances will probably just end up getting a pass anyways and at the end of the day no system is in place to help with the problem of bot/spamming users on trusted instances (whether in that WoT or just blindly trusted by the WoT).
Most of the spam I get is from gmail addresses, I don’t see it going any differently here.
I agree that we need far stronger admin and moderation tools to fight spam and bots. I disagree with the idea of a whitelist approach, and think taking even more from email (probably the largest federated system ever) could go a long way.
With email, there is no central authority granting “permission” for me to send stuff. There are technologies like SPF, DKIM, DMARC, and FcRDNS, which act as a minimum bar to reach before most servers trust you at all, then server-side spam filtering gets applied on top and happens at a user, domain, IP, and sometimes netblock level. When rejections occur, receiving servers provide rejection information, that let me figure out what is wrong and contact the admins of that particular server. (Establish a baseline of trust, punish if trust is violated)
A gray-listing system for new users or domains could generate reports once there is a sufficient amount of activity to ease the information gathering an admin would have to do in order to trust a certain domain. Additionally, I think establishing a way for admins to share their blacklisting actions regarding spam or other malicious behavior (with verifiable proof) could achieve similar outcomes to whitelisting without forcing every instance operator to buy in to a centralized (or one of a few centralized) authority on this. This would basically be an RBL (which admins could choose to use) for Lemmy. This could be very customizable and allow for network effects (“I trust X admin, apply any server block they make to my instance too” sort of stuff).
I think enhancements to Lemmy itself would also address help. Lemmy itself could provide a framework for filtering and report when an instance refuses a federated message with relevant information, allowing admins to make informed decisions (and see when there are potential problems on their instance). Also having ways to attach proof of bad behavior to federated bans at an instance level, and some way to federate bans (again with proof) from servers that aren’t a user’s home instance.
